Merge branch 'dev' of bin.github.com:fit2cloudrd/metersphere-server into dev

This commit is contained in:
Captain.B 2020-02-20 12:56:22 +08:00
commit 61715c2d52
2 changed files with 5 additions and 3 deletions

View File

@ -33,11 +33,11 @@ public class LoadTestController {
}
@PostMapping(value = "/save", consumes = {"multipart/form-data"})
public void save(
public String save(
@RequestPart("request") SaveTestPlanRequest request,
@RequestPart(value = "file") MultipartFile file
) {
loadTestService.save(request, file);
return loadTestService.save(request, file);
}
@PostMapping(value = "/edit", consumes = {"multipart/form-data"})

View File

@ -71,7 +71,7 @@ public class LoadTestService {
fileService.deleteFileByTestId(request.getId());
}
public void save(SaveTestPlanRequest request, MultipartFile file) {
public String save(SaveTestPlanRequest request, MultipartFile file) {
if (file == null) {
throw new IllegalArgumentException("文件不能为空!");
}
@ -84,6 +84,8 @@ public class LoadTestService {
loadTestFile.setTestId(loadTest.getId());
loadTestFile.setFileId(fileMetadata.getId());
loadTestFileMapper.insert(loadTestFile);
return loadTest.getId();
}
private LoadTestWithBLOBs saveLoadTest(SaveTestPlanRequest request) {